Course summary

Explore how social influences and structures affect our thoughts, emotions and actions, with hands-on learning in social, developmental, clinical and cognitive psychology, alongside sociology.

Active learning
Learn as you practise – you'll develop practical skills for your future career through hands-on activities in our psychology experiential learning lab, building experience from the start.

Real-world experience
Apply your skills and knowledge with an optional placement year, or take part in an international exchange year by studying abroad. This builds your confidence and broadens your experience.

Personalise your studies
You'll get to know the subjects you love. Our option-based final year gives you complete flexibility to focus on the areas of psychology that interest you the most.

This course is for you if...

  • you're intrigued by how thoughts, feelings and motivations shape behaviour

  • you want to build practical skills through hands-on learning

  • you seek the freedom to explore areas of psychology that interest you

  • you want to learn about the interaction between the individual mind and the social world we live in.
